Gillian is sitting in a crowded coffee shop when she hears the squeal of brakes and the crash of metal-on-metal. She looks around and notices that all the other customers remain engrossed in their conversations.
 
  Because these cool and calm responses ________, Gillian will be ________.
  a. provide normative cues; more likely to go outside to help
  b. increase pluralistic ignorance; less likely to assume it's an emergency situation
  c. decrease evaluation apprehension; more likely to go outside to help
  d. reduce Gillian's sense of personal responsibility; less likely to go outside to help

Using the stage model of the decisions bystanders make before helping (or not helping) in an emergency, which of the following is NOT one of the stages in the model?
 
  a. noticing the event
  b. altruism
  c. assuming responsibility
  d. implementing the decision to help or not help
